Cowboys’ DB coach on board with Ezekiel Elliott over Jalen Ramsey

The Dallas Cowboys faced an interesting decision with the fourth overall pick in last week’s draft – Ohio State running back Ezekiel Elliott or Florida State defensive back Jalen Ramsey.

Both were coveted by the team, but they ultimately felt Elliott gave them the better chance to win in the immediate future. And secondary coach Joe Baker is more than OK with how everything played out even though they passed on a player (Ramsey) that some felt ranked as the top player of the class.

Baker, who is going into his fifth season with the team, remembered the 2014 season when DeMarco Murray carried the offense and the Cowboys owned the time of possession. That kept the defense fresh and the hope is that Elliott provides a similar type game.

“I remember what that was like when we were running the rock and the DBs were drinking a lot of Gatorade on the sideline. I loved that,” Baker said, chuckling. “So I’m all-in. And we ended up getting two DBs who we feel like are really good additions to the secondary. So I feel like we’ve gotten better also.”

In 2014, behind Murray and a strong running game, the Cowboys ranked first in time of possession by having the ball 32:51 of the 60-minute game. Last year, they possessed it 31:07 and were 13th in the league.

And, the players Baker is referring to, are the Cowboys using sixth-round picks on cornerback Anthony Brown and safety Kavon Frazier. Neither of them, though, is expected to get anywhere close to the level of Ramsey.

At the end of the day, Baker knows what’s best for the organization and understands the impact Elliott can make.

“They’re all such great players. It was one of those things where you really couldn’t go wrong with either one of those guys,” Baker said. “And I know we all feel like Ezekiel makes the whole team better. So I’m 100 percent on board.”
